A response from Michael Choi MP, received on the 23rd March 2004:-       (TOP)

Dear Ms Bax,
 
First of all may I apologise for the delay in replying to your email.
 
May I also congratulate you for your resolve and enduring quest in bringing the issue of seat belts on buses to the forth front of the public debate.
 
As you are aware the trial of seatbelts on school buses was conducted in response to recommendations made by the independent School Transport Safety Task Force and the Interdepartmental Working Group. The Working group has been reconvened to examine the results of the trial and further investigate issues such as legal responsibility and compliance.
 
I was informed that the taskforce will provide recommendations to the government by April 2004.
 
Not wanting to pre-empt the recommendations and the fact that I do not have any expertise in transport safety, I have to admit that it would not be difficult to see the benefit of having seat belts on buses, particularly when the safety of children is at stake.
 
The next question is likely to be a matter of funding priorities.
 
May I assure you that I will work with my colleagues to see that the recommendations of the report are implemented as soon as possible.
 
Thank you for bring this matter to my attention and my best wishes for your endeavour.
 
Yours faithfully,
Michael Choi MP
 
NB. Yes, I have read the articles by Senior Seargant Ruler as well as Professor Peter Joubert.         (TOP)
